Turkey - Male Upper Secondary Education School Age Population

Since 2014, Turkey Male Upper Secondary Education School Age Population rose 1.6% year on year. With 2,921,889 Persons in 2019, the country was number 11 comparing other countries in Male Upper Secondary Education School Age Population. Turkey is overtaken by Democratic Republic of the Congo, which was ranked number 10 with 3,625,208 Persons and is followed by Ethiopia with 2,421,869 Persons. India topped the ranking with 53,738,635.73 Persons in 2019, that is a growth of 0.7% versus 2018. China, Pakistan and Indonesia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Gambia witnessed the best average annual growth at +4.5% per year, while Latvia witnessed the worst performance at -7.6% per year.
